10 Pro Tips for Choosing the Perfect Polarized Shades

When it comes to selecting polarized sunglasses, there are a few key factors to consider to ensure you find the perfect pair that not only looks great but also provides optimal protection and comfort. Here are some expert tips to guide you through the process:
1. Understand Polarization

Polarized lenses are designed to reduce glare and enhance visual clarity by filtering out intense reflected light. This technology is particularly beneficial when driving, fishing, or engaging in outdoor activities where glare can be a nuisance. By understanding how polarization works, you can appreciate its advantages and make an informed choice.
2. Choose the Right Lens Color

Polarized lenses come in various colors, each offering unique benefits. Gray lenses provide true-color perception and are ideal for general use, while brown lenses enhance contrast and are excellent for outdoor sports. Yellow lenses improve contrast and visibility in low-light conditions, making them perfect for cloudy days or driving at night. Consider your specific needs and choose a lens color that suits your activities.
3. Consider Lens Material

The material used for polarized lenses can impact their durability and performance. Polycarbonate lenses are lightweight, impact-resistant, and affordable, making them a popular choice for active individuals. Glass lenses offer superior optical clarity and scratch resistance but may be heavier. Plastic lenses provide a balance between durability and affordability. Assess your lifestyle and select the lens material that best aligns with your needs.
4. Check Lens Quality

High-quality polarized lenses should meet certain standards. Look for lenses that block 100% of UVA and UVB rays to ensure adequate eye protection. Additionally, check for optical clarity, ensuring the lenses are free from distortion or imperfections. Reputable brands often provide certifications or guarantees, so research and choose a reputable manufacturer to ensure you receive high-quality polarized lenses.
5. Frame Fit and Comfort

The frame’s fit and comfort are crucial for an enjoyable wearing experience. Choose a frame that fits snugly but comfortably on your face, ensuring it stays in place during active movements. Consider the nose pads and temples, ensuring they are adjustable and provide a secure grip without causing discomfort. A well-fitted frame will enhance your overall satisfaction with the sunglasses.
6. Consider Your Face Shape

Selecting a frame that complements your face shape can enhance your overall look. If you have a round face, opt for angular frames to create balance. Square faces can benefit from rounded frames to soften their features. Oval faces are versatile and can pull off various frame styles. Heart-shaped faces look great with frames that have a deep, narrow upper frame and wider lower frame. Consider your face shape and choose a frame that flatters your features.

8. Explore Additional Features

Modern polarized sunglasses often come with additional features that enhance their functionality. Look for options like photochromic lenses, which automatically adjust their tint based on light conditions, providing optimal protection and visibility. Mirror coatings can reduce glare and add a stylish touch. Anti-reflective coatings minimize internal reflections, improving visual clarity. Consider your specific needs and choose sunglasses with features that align with your activities and preferences.

FAQ
Are polarized lenses suitable for driving?

+
Yes, polarized lenses are highly beneficial for driving as they reduce glare from reflected light, improving visibility and reducing eye strain. They enhance contrast and visual clarity, making it easier to see road signs and potential hazards.
Can polarized lenses be worn in low-light conditions?

+
While polarized lenses are excellent for reducing glare in bright conditions, they may not be suitable for low-light situations. In dim lighting, they can reduce the overall brightness, making it harder to see. It’s best to have a pair of clear lenses or consider photochromic lenses that adjust to different light levels.
